Output e66202c83119a482b8d2f954faa36b43bdbdfd95cb17ec919e7bdf4034c7d68b:0

value
1041505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f02548ec7005b533adfebef4897ad205e18a4c3 OP_EQUAL
address
334NrLJHygAvBK5CHhtumo8TTHLapL8BTq
transaction
e66202c83119a482b8d2f954faa36b43bdbdfd95cb17ec919e7bdf4034c7d68b
spent
true